How to Make Blue Moon Ice Cream
Creating Blue Moon Ice Cream is a delightful journey. You get to mix, churn, and freeze a blend of creamy goodness that’s just like the ice cream truck favorites. Let’s dive into the simple steps to bring this nostalgic treat to life!
Step 1: Whisk the Cream Base
Start by grabbing a large bowl. In it, combine the heavy cream, whole milk, and granulated sugar. Whisk everything together until the sugar dissolves completely. Aim for about 2-3 minutes of whisking. The goal? A smooth, creamy base that makes your heart sing!
Step 2: Add Flavorings
Now it’s time to introduce some magic. Stir in the vanilla and almond extracts. These two flavors create that signature taste we all love. Make sure to mix well, so the flavors dance together throughout the cream base.
Step 3: Color It Blue
Here comes the fun part! Add a few drops of blue food coloring to your mixture. Stir it in and pause to behold the transformation. The shade of blue can be adjusted according to your whim. Feel free to add more until you reach that vibrant hue that reminds you of summer skies!
Step 4: Churn the Ice Cream
Pour your beautiful blue mixture into an ice cream maker. Follow your manufacturer’s instructions—typically, it takes about 20-25 minutes of churning. Just like that, your creamy treat will begin to take shape!
Step 5: Incorporate Cherries
If you’re feeling fruity, gently fold in chopped maraschino cherries during the last few minutes of churning. They add a burst of sweetness and color, enhancing your Blue Moon Ice Cream experience. Just be careful not to overmix!
Step 6: Freeze and Serve
Your ice cream is almost ready! Transfer it to an airtight container. Don’t forget to place a piece of plastic wrap on the surface before sealing the lid—as it helps prevent ice crystals. Freeze your creation for at least 4 hours. When you’re ready to serve, let it sit at room temperature for about 5 minutes. This allows for easy scooping and ensures it’s perfect every time!

Blue Moon Ice Cream
- Total Time: 4 hours 35 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
A nostalgic creamy dessert with a distinctive almond-vanilla flavor and a vibrant blue color, reminiscent of childhood summer treats.
Ingredients
- 2 cups heavy cream
- 1 cup whole milk
- 3/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 teaspoon almond extract
- Blue food coloring, as needed
- 1/4 cup maraschino cherries, chopped (optional)
Instructions
- In a large bowl, whisk together the heavy cream, whole milk, and granulated sugar until the sugar is completely dissolved. Continue whisking for about 2-3 minutes to ensure a smooth consistency.
- Stir in the vanilla extract and almond extract, mixing well to distribute the flavors evenly throughout the base.
- Add several drops of blue food coloring and stir well, adjusting until the desired color is achieved.
- Pour the blue mixture into your ice cream maker and churn according to the manufacturer’s instructions (usually 20-25 minutes).
- If using maraschino cherries, fold them gently into the churned ice cream until evenly distributed.
- Transfer the ice cream to an airtight container, placing plastic wrap on the surface before securing the lid, and freeze for at least 4 hours.
- Once fully frozen, scoop into bowls or cones and serve.
Notes
- The exact flavor of Blue Moon ice cream varies by region and manufacturer.
- For extra creaminess, substitute part of the whole milk with half-and-half.
- Let the ice cream sit at room temperature for about 5 minutes before scooping for the perfect consistency.
